I've just had a “Domestic Electrical Installation Periodic Inspection Report” carried out for a property that I intend to let out, unfortunately the safety check failed on some items so therefore the electrician marked the report as “Unsatisfactory”, which is totally understandable on my part.
However, the work listed on page 2 of 3 has all been carried out by another electrician (as it was cheaper to do so).
I contacted the initial electrician to say the work had been completed, he advised me to use some Tipex and change the word “unsatisfactory” to “satisfactory” on pages 1 and 2 as the report had already been signed on the first page to say all was good.
I’m a little confused so here are the questions:
Does the report need to be re-certified by the electrician?
Will this electrical report be valid if I simply use Tipex to take the “un” out of “unsatisfactory”?
Is the company who carried out this test allowed to this?
Or am I being over cautious and this is perfectly legitimate?
